Mid-Century Modern Magic: A Timeless Aesthetic
The Kwpcvz Chandelier isn’t just a light source; it’s a design statement. It draws heavily from the Mid-Century Modern (MCM) aesthetic, a style that emerged in the mid-20th century (roughly the 1930s to the 1960s) and continues to captivate design enthusiasts today. MCM is characterized by clean lines, organic forms, a focus on functionality, and a lack of excessive ornamentation. Think Mad Men, sleek furniture, and an emphasis on bringing the outdoors in.
What makes MCM so enduring? Perhaps it’s the inherent optimism of the era it represents – a post-war period of innovation and progress. Or maybe it’s the style’s inherent versatility; it can blend seamlessly with both contemporary and more traditional interiors. The Kwpcvz Chandelier embodies this versatility. Its linear form, reminiscent of a constellation or the iconic Sputnik satellite (hence the “sputnik” designation often given to similar designs), provides a touch of retro charm, while the clean lines and uncluttered design keep it firmly rooted in the present.
The Dance of Light and Glass: Understanding Illumination
Before we delve into the specific materials of the Kwpcvz Chandelier, let’s take a moment to appreciate the science of light itself. Light, as you may recall from physics class, is a form of electromagnetic radiation. It travels in waves, and the wavelength of that light determines its color. What we perceive as “white” light is actually a combination of all the colors of the rainbow.
When light encounters a surface, several things can happen. It can be reflected (bounced back), absorbed (converted into heat), or transmitted (passed through). The way a material interacts with light determines its appearance and its suitability for different lighting applications.
The Kwpcvz Chandelier utilizes clear glass, a material chosen for its excellent light transmission properties. Clear glass allows a high percentage of light to pass through it, minimizing light loss and maximizing the brightness of the bulbs. But it’s not just about letting the light through; it’s also about how it lets the light through.
The ribbed design of the glass globes on the Kwpcvz Chandelier is crucial. These ridges act as tiny prisms, refracting the light – bending it as it passes from the air, through the glass, and back into the air. This refraction causes the light to diffuse, or spread out in different directions. This diffusion is what creates that soft, ambient glow, eliminating harsh shadows and creating a more comfortable and visually appealing environment. Think of it like the difference between staring directly at the sun (ouch!) and looking at a softly lit cloud – the same light source, but a vastly different experience.
Brass: Beauty and Brawn
The framework of the Kwpcvz Chandelier is crafted from metal with an electroplated brass finish. Let’s break that down. Electroplating is a fascinating process where a thin layer of one metal (in this case, brass) is deposited onto another metal (often steel or another less expensive, but strong, metal) using an electric current.
Here’s a simplified explanation: Imagine a bath filled with a solution containing dissolved brass ions (brass atoms that have lost some electrons, giving them a positive charge). The metal object to be coated (the chandelier frame) is placed in the bath and connected to the negative terminal of a power source. A piece of pure brass is connected to the positive terminal. When the power is turned on, the positively charged brass ions are attracted to the negatively charged chandelier frame. As they come into contact with the frame, they gain electrons and become solid brass, forming a thin, even coating.
Why brass? Brass, an alloy of copper and zinc, offers a beautiful, warm, golden hue that complements a wide range of interior styles. It’s also known for its durability and resistance to corrosion. The electroplated finish provides the aesthetic appeal of solid brass without the associated cost and weight. It’s a win-win: beauty and practicality.
Glass: Clarity and Character
We’ve already touched on the light transmission properties of clear glass, but let’s delve a bit deeper. Glass is an amorphous solid, meaning it lacks the long-range, ordered structure of a crystalline material like a diamond. This amorphous structure is what gives glass its unique ability to transmit light.
The clarity of the glass used in the Kwpcvz Chandelier is essential for maximizing the light output of the bulbs. Impurities or imperfections in the glass could scatter or absorb light, reducing its brightness and creating unwanted distortions. The ribbed texture, as we discussed earlier, adds a layer of visual interest while also serving the crucial function of diffusing the light.

The G9 Advantage: Small Bulb, Big Impact
The Kwpcvz Chandelier is designed to use G9 bulbs. The “G9” refers to the type of base – a two-pin configuration with the pins spaced 9 millimeters apart. While G9 bulbs can be halogen, it’s highly recommended to use LED G9 bulbs with this fixture.
LED (Light Emitting Diode) technology represents a significant advancement in lighting efficiency. Unlike traditional incandescent bulbs, which produce light by heating a filament until it glows, LEDs produce light through a process called electroluminescence. This process is far more energy-efficient, converting a much larger percentage of electricity into light rather than heat. This means you get more light for less energy consumption, resulting in lower electricity bills and a smaller carbon footprint.
LEDs also have a significantly longer lifespan than incandescent or halogen bulbs, often lasting for tens of thousands of hours. This reduces the frequency of bulb replacements, saving you time and money. Furthermore, G9 LED bulbs are available in a range of color temperatures, measured in Kelvins (K). Lower Kelvin values (around 2700K-3000K) produce a warm, yellowish light, ideal for creating a cozy and inviting atmosphere. Higher Kelvin values (around 4000K-5000K) produce a cooler, whiter light, which is better suited for tasks that require greater visual acuity. Keeping it Sparkling: Care and Maintenance
Like any beautiful object, the Kwpcvz Chandelier will require occasional care to maintain its luster. Fortunately, cleaning is relatively straightforward. For the glass globes, simply remove them from the fixture (once they’ve cooled down, of course!) and wash them gently with warm, soapy water. Avoid using abrasive cleaners or scouring pads, as these could scratch the glass. A soft microfiber cloth is ideal for drying and polishing.
For the metal frame, a damp cloth is usually sufficient to remove dust and fingerprints. If necessary, you can use a mild, non-abrasive metal cleaner, but be sure to test it in an inconspicuous area first. Avoid getting any moisture inside the electrical components of the fixture.
